39.12.1 TWI Control Register
Name: 
TWI_CR
Addresses:
0xF8010000 (0), 0xF8014000 (1)
Access: Write-only
Reset: 0x00000000
• START: Send a START Condition
0: No effect.
1: A frame beginning with a START bit is transmitted according to the features defined in the mode register.
This action is necessary when the TWI peripheral wants to read data from a slave. When configured in Master Mode with a write 
operation, a frame is sent as soon as the user writes a character in the Transmit Holding Register (TWI_THR).
• STOP: Send a STOP Condition
0: No effect.
1: STOP Condition is sent just after completing the current byte transmission in master read mode.
– In single data byte master read, the START and STOP must both be set. 
– In multiple data bytes master read, the STOP must be set after the last data received but one.
– In master read mode, if a NACK bit is received, the STOP is automatically performed.
– In master data write operation, a STOP condition will be sent after the transmission of the current data is 
finished.
• MSEN: TWI Master Mode Enabled
0: No effect.
1: If MSDIS = 0, the master mode is enabled. 
Note:
Switching from Slave to Master mode is only permitted when TXCOMP = 1.
• MSDIS:  TWI  Master Mode Disabled
0: No effect.
1: The master mode is disabled, all pending data is transmitted. The shifter and holding characters (if it contains data) are trans-
mitted in case of write operation. In read operation, the character being transferred must be completely received before disabling.
• SVEN: TWI Slave Mode Enabled
0: No effect.
1: If SVDIS = 0, the slave mode is enabled.
Note:
Switching from Master to Slave mode is only permitted when TXCOMP = 1.
